EPISODE CONTEXT

Episode 4 closes out the opening stretch of Chainsaw Man's first season, serving as the direct aftermath of Denji and Power's confrontation with the Bat Devil in Episode 3. It transitions the series from its initial setup phase — establishing Denji's contract, his motivations, and his uneasy alliance with Power — into the broader team dynamics and organizational structure that will drive the middle portion of the season. This is the bridge episode where early conflicts crystallize into lasting character relationships, setting the foundation for the escalating threats ahead.
